Tóm tắt tiếng anh
This paper presents the implementation of a decentralized modulation for the control of multilevel converters requiring phase-shifted carriers. Contrary to the principle using a 'master' controller providing a set of interleaved carriers, the proposed method uses local interconnections between different independent elementary controllers allowing them to self-align their own carrier regardless the number of actives cells. � 2017 IEEE.
